The Meteorological Department has predicted showers between 150 - 200mm in the Northern Province today (Dec 6).
This weather condition is likely to be experienced in the Jaffna, Kilinochchi, Mullaitivu, Mannar, and Vavuniya districts, today's weather forecast read.
Further, heavy showers between 100 and 150mm could be experienced in the Anuradhapura, Polonnaruwa, Trincomalee, Batticaloa, Ampara, Nuwara-Eliya, Badulla and Monaragala districts.
More than 30,000 individuals have been affected due to the inclement weather influenced by the North-East monsoon, Disaster Management Centre (DMC) statistics show.
More than 600 families have been sheltered at some 30 state-run relief centres, the DMC said.
